how do you get a fuel pressure gauge built into a rail....I like that.
02-12-2007, 06:22 PM
#388 (permalink )
User Banned
Join Date: Jun 2006
Member Number: 42559
Location: Down there.
Posts: 2,302
There is actually a bolt you unscrew in some aftermarket rails, and screw the gauge right in. Mine isn't liquid filled, But I really would like to get one being all the vibrations int he enginebay. I seen a non liquid filled fp gauge break and get stuck. It cost him a complete new motor. It was sad.
